A biologist had mice and rats run through a maze and recorded the number that finished the maze successfully and the number that did not. This table lists the results of the study. At a = .05, test the claim that the rodent type and the success of finishing the maze are not related.
.........................Mice..........RatsFinished.............30.............22Did not Finish....36.............13
A) There is evidence to reject the claim that the rodent type and the success of finishing the maze are not related because the test value 9.488 > 1.393
B) There is not evidence to reject the claim that the rodent type and the success of finishing the maze are not related because the test value 2.773 < 3.841
C) There is not evidence to reject the claim that the rodent type and the success of finishing the maze are not related because the test value 1.393 < 9.488
D) There is evidence to reject the claim that the rodent type and the success of finishing the maze are not related because the test value 3.841 > 2.773
